Covid: European Parliament asks for free tests for Green Pass

by admin

Brussels, April 28 (beraking latest news Salute) – The European Parliament is pushing for the tests necessary to obtain the future Green Pass, in the event that a citizen cannot, or does not want to, be vaccinated against Covid-19, are free. “The certificate must be free – the Spanish socialist Juan Fernando Lopez Aguilar, former Minister of Justice of the Zapatero government, said in plenary in Brussels – and so must the tests, which in some Member States have prohibitive prices. mandatory test “.

Justice Commissioner Didier Reynders in the courtroom merely hopes that the tests will have “accessible prices”, but adds that “the competence lies with the Member States”. The Dutch liberal Sophie In’t Veld thugs him: “Do you believe – she says – that citizens want a debate on subsidiarity, on what is national competence and what is community competence? Citizens want their freedom, they want to travel”. The Commission, In’t Veld insists, “has all the competences on the internal market: tests that are sold on the market on a commercial basis can be regulated. Come on Commissioner, be a little creative.”

The EPP, the first party in Europe, is also on the same line: “The tests carried out in connection with the certificate must be free”, underlines the Dutch Christian Democrat Jeroen Lenaers. And even the Conservatives and Reformists are on the same line on this: Nicola Procaccini of the Brothers of Italy agrees on the principle of free testing.
